The Surgical Process: Accuracy and Expertise at work
When you step into the operating room, the atmosphere shifts; your focus develops as you prepare to execute LASIK surgery. mouse click the next web site evaluate the person's graph, making sure every information is represented.
As you assist the patient with the process, you assure them while keeping a tranquil atmosphere. You position the client under the laser and apply numbing decreases, minimizing pain.
With precision, you produce a thin flap in the cornea, using either a microkeratome or femtosecond laser. The minute the laser triggers, you keep track of the therapy, adjusting settings as necessary.
You meticulously reposition the flap, guaranteeing it's perfectly aligned. The procedure takes simple mins, but your knowledge makes certain every action is implemented flawlessly, supplying life-altering outcomes.
